Mythos beer is brewed in Greece, Sindo's at S.A. Mythos Breweries. The beer was launched in May 1997. Mythos beer also won an award at the 2001 Interbeer International Beer and Whisky competition.
In Scotland, people commonly drink whisky, beer, and tea. Whisky, particularly Scotch whisky, is a popular choice both domestically and internationally. Beer, including traditional ales and lagers, is also widely consumed. Tea is a common beverage enjoyed throughout the day.
